Strength-training exercises likewise help relieve signs of depression, according to an analysis of 21 research studies published in 2020. In a similar way, one more review of researches showed that adults that exercise with weights are much less most likely to create depression than those that never ever exercise with weights. Along with the straight effects workout has on the mind, other physical modifications that accompany exercise, such as cardio health and fitness and improved metabolic health and wellness, promote mind health indirectly.
